Description

Who we are: CCPC is a Christian, humanitarian community resource center that helps improve the lives of people and communities by meeting immediate and basic needs, serving as a leading networker of community resources, offering counseling and care support, and giving hope to those we serve. Position : Neurofeedback Technician Reports to : Director of Counseling & Wellness Center Employment Type : Part-Time Hourly Pay Range:  $22-$28 per hour Position Summary The Neurofeedback Technician supports children and adult clients in improving cognitive flexibility and control, helping alleviate symptoms related to mental health conditions such as ADHD, anxiety, depression, insomnia, and chronic pain. This role emphasizes delivering high-quality care and collaborating with the clinical team to maximize client outcomes. Scope of Duties Treatment & Client Care Develop and implement neurofeedback treatment plans tailored to individual client needs. Administer neuropsychological assessments and collect comprehensive health/medical/neuro intake data. Acquire and submit quantitative EEG data for further processing. Monitor and evaluate client responses to neurofeedback sessions, coordinating with the clinical team for any adjustments. Maintain clear, detailed, and confidential records of sessions, goals, and treatment responses on the CCPC electronic health records system. Communication & Coordination Maintain regular communication with clients' therapists to discuss patient care issues, behavior/safety plans, and any therapeutic challenges. Schedule client appointments using the CCPC electronic health records system. Complete intake paperwork and create profiles for new clients. Equipment Management Clean, maintain, and inventory neurofeedback equipment, supplies and office. Communicate supply needs to the Office Coordinator. Training, Meetings, & Supervision Attend required training and supervision sessions. Communicate availability with the Director of Counseling and the administrative team. Participate in monthly staff meetings and occasional collaboration meetings, contributing to discussions on client care quality. Meet with the Director of Counseling & Wellness monthly. General & Other Duties Represent CCPC values in all professional interactions. Perform additional duties as assigned (W2 only). Expectations Demonstrate a commitment to the values of collaboration, excellence, leadership, and respect. Ability to work independently with strong problem-solving skills and multitasking abilities. Uphold HIPAA confidentiality in all client-related activities. Complete background checks, review and acknowledge necessary policies, standard operating procedures, and codes of conduct. Maintain current malpractice insurance. Meet professional credentialing or licensure requirements. Ability to work face-to-face with clients in a professional and sensitive manner, especially when working with diverse and vulnerable populations. Qualifications Neurofeedback training, with preference given to experience in the Othmer Method (ILF) and IASIS (MCN). Commitment to ongoing learning and professional development in neurofeedback and related areas. Strong computer and technical skills. Knowledge of neurophysiology, anatomy, EEG brain waves, neurofeedback equipment, brain training techniques, and the effects of nutrition on the brain. Demonstrated teamwork, organizational, and communication skills. Ability to protect client privacy, uphold client dignity, and provide excellent customer service.
